Its not us, its Wii...

Midway has decided to pass the buck on the fact that the last string of games it has made have been mediocre, to say the least.

"The demand for Wii product has put a pretty big strain on Nintendo's production capacity, and that has in turn, for us, turned into longer lead times for some of our Wii products," commented Iribarren. -Source

In other words, the reason that Mortal Combat sucked on every system was because the Wii wasn't in stock.

The good news is they apparently have resolved their PS3 woes and can now focus on bringing its Xbox360 ports - erm, I mean original IPs to Sony's console on time.

    You are showing your youth on this one. You must be young to not know that at one time Midway was awesome. Titles like Area 51, Cruis'n USA, Gauntlet, Hydro Thunder, the original Mortal Kombat, NBA Jam, Rampage, Smash TV. Pretty much everything they did in the arcades was great. It's the move to home consoles that killed them. So, they haven't always made mediocre games.
